Since there's been so much lamentation, here are some ideas to make the north a little less peaceful.

1. Jack up your taxes until a duchy secedes.
2. Secede a duchy anyway, make up a reason. Maybe you consider the Northern Isle "The True Astrum" and all those chumps to the north are freeloading immigrants leaching off of your sacrifices.
3. Create a secret anti-astroist society and build up power then start a rebellion.
4. Start a rebellion for some other reason. Remember those taxes I was talking about?
5. Get into a fight over who gets to make Libero Empire their vassal state.
6. Get into a fight over who gets the mountain range between Niselur and Astrum. Remember there's been talk of making mountains more valuable as a source of resources.
